Proton Coin Profile

Proton was first traded on March 22nd, 2020. Proton’s total supply is 31,216,807,600 coins and its circulating supply is 28,286,445,350 coins. According to CryptoCompare, “Proton (XPR) is a new public blockchain and smart contract platform designed for both consumer applications and peer-peer payments. It is built around a secure identity and financial settlements layer that allows users to directly link real identity and fiat accounts, pull funds and buy crypto, and use that crypto seamlessly in apps.”
